Shiitake quinoa risotto (vegan)
- 4 oz shiitake mushrooms (caps only), sliced
- 1 cup quinoa
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1/4 onion, finely diced (or shallot if your cupboard is better stocked than mine)
- 2 tbsp olive oil
- 4 c vegetable stock
- 1/2c white wine
- 2 tbsp vegan butter
- Splash vegan creamer
Sauté shiitake until soft, about 5 minutes. Remove and set aside. Sauté garlic and onion in olive oil for 2 minutes on low. Add quinoa and toast about 1 minute. Add wine. Slowly add broth while stirring about 10 minutes. Add butter, cream and shiitakes. Season with salt and pepper.
